Competition Introduction:

Windows CE is Microsoft’s modular real-time embedded OS for mobile intelligent connected devices. It’s widely used in PDAs, smartphones, automotive electronics, and information terminals.

Huaheng Technology (http://www.hhcn.com) is a renowned domestic embedded Linux and Windows CE platform provider. Tongji Software Institute and Huaheng jointly organize this “Huaheng Cup” Windows CE Development Competition to:

  1. Prepare for the Microsoft-Tongji Windows Embedded Teaching Symposium in Spring 2005
  2. Promote embedded systems and Windows CE knowledge
  3. Provide a stage for developers and outstanding works
  4. Cultivate innovation awareness

Eligibility: All Tongji undergraduate, master’s, and PhD students.

Registration: Dec 15, 2004 – Feb 1, 2005. Email or phone.

Submission Deadline: Feb 20, 2005

Awards: First prize (3 teams, 3000 RMB each), Second prize (6 teams, 2000 RMB each), Third prize (12 teams, 1000 RMB each).
